Rhythm Heaven Groove Launches on July 2nd for Nintendo Switch

Following a six-year gap since Rhythm Heaven Megamix, Rhythm Heaven Groove continues the series’ tradition of quick, quirky minigames similar to those found in WarioWare. The game also features voice acting with a charming, sing-song quality reminiscent of Tomodachi Life.

Netflix’s Ray Gunn From Incredibles Director Recruits Major Marvel Stars (First Look Revealed)

Sam Rockwell, who has won an Academy Award, and Academy Award nominees Scarlett Johansson and Tom Waits are all starring in the new series Ray Gunn. Rockwell will play the lead role of Raymond Gunn, while Johansson will provide the voice for Venus Nova, a famous multimedia personality who’s key to the show’s central mystery. Waits will voice Eyera, an alien character who appears to be helping Gunn. The series is set in Metropia, a futuristic city designed with the look and feel of 1939, and follows Raymond Gunn – the last human private detective – as he investigates a case filled with aliens, murder, and the captivating Nova.
